网站网页制作怎么样-网站网页制作效果如何
摘要:在数字化时代,网站网页制作已成为企业和个人展示自己的重要手段。本文将探讨网站网页制作的各个方面,从基础的HTML和CSS知识到高级的JavaScript和框架技术,旨在帮助读者全面了解如何创建和管理一个有效的网站。我们将介绍如何选择适合的编程语言、设计原则、用户体验的重要性以及如何利用现代工具和技术来提升网站的视觉效果和功能性。此外,文章还将讨论网站维护和更新的重要性,以及如何应对可能出现的技术问题。我们将提供一些建议,帮助读者评估和选择最佳的网站开发方案。文章大纲:
1.引言: 简述网站网页制作的重要性及其对现代商业的影响。
2.基础知识: - HTML与CSS:介绍HTML标签和CSS样式的基本概念。 - JavaScript:解释JavaScript在动态网页中的作用。
3.高级主题: - 前端框架:介绍流行的前端框架如React或Vue.js。 - 响应式设计:讨论如何使网站适应不同的屏幕尺寸。
4.用户体验: - 交互设计:强调用户界面设计的基本原则。 - 可用性测试:介绍如何进行用户体验测试以改进网站。
5.现代工具和技术: - 前端开发工具:列举常用的开发工具。 - 性能优化:解释如何提高网站的性能和速度。
6.维护与更新: - 内容管理:讨论如何有效管理网站内容。 - 安全性:强调保护网站免受黑客攻击的重要性。
7.挑战与解决方案: - 技术挑战:讨论在网站开发过程中可能遇到的常见问题。 - 解决策略:提供针对常见挑战的解决方案。
8.结论: 总结文章要点,强调持续学习和实践的重要性。正文开始前:
随着互联网技术的飞速发展,网站网页制作已经成为了现代社会不可或缺的一部分。无论是个人还是企业,都需要通过网站来展示自己的形象、传递信息、吸引客户。因此,掌握网站网页制作的相关知识和技能,对于现代人来说显得尤为重要。本文将从基础知识入手,逐步深入到高级主题,为大家提供一个全面、系统的学习指南。
一、基础知识:
1.HTML与CSS: HTML(HyperText Markup Language)和CSS(Cascading Style Sheets)是网站网页制作的基础。HTML用于构建网页的结构,而CSS则负责定义网页的样式和布局。通过学习HTML和CSS,你可以创建一个基本的静态网页。
2.JavaScript: 虽然JavaScript主要用于客户端脚本语言,但它在动态网站开发中扮演着重要角色。通过JavaScript,你可以实现页面的交互效果,如点击按钮后显示隐藏的元素等。
二、高级主题:
1.前端框架: 前端框架如React或Vue.js为开发者提供了一种更高效、可重用的方式来构建复杂的用户界面。这些框架简化了开发流程,使得开发者能够专注于业务逻辑而非界面细节。
2.响应式设计: 为了适应各种设备和屏幕尺寸,响应式设计变得至关重要。这意味着你的网站能够自动调整布局和元素大小,以确保在不同设备上都能提供良好的用户体验。
三、用户体验:
1.交互设计: 用户体验(UX)设计的核心在于创造直观、易用的界面。这包括了解用户的需求、痛点以及期望,然后通过设计来满足这些需求。
2.可用性测试: 可用性测试是一种评估网站用户体验的方法。通过模拟真实用户的使用场景,可以发现潜在的问题并加以改进。
四、现代工具和技术:
1.前端开发工具: 市场上有许多优秀的前端开发工具,如Visual Studio Code、WebStorm等,它们可以帮助你更好地组织代码、调试和发布网站。
2.性能优化: 网站加载速度是影响用户体验的关键因素之一。通过优化图片大小、减少HTTP请求、使用缓存等方法,可以显著提高网站的加载速度。
五、维护与更新:
1.内容管理: 定期更新和维护网站内容是保持其活跃度的关键。确保内容的质量和相关性,以满足用户的需求和期望。
2.安全性: 网站的安全性不容忽视。通过实施https、防止SQL注入、使用安全的API等措施,可以有效保护网站免受黑客攻击。
六、挑战与解决方案:
1.技术挑战: 在网站开发过程中,你可能会遇到各种技术挑战,如性能问题、兼容性问题等。面对这些挑战,你需要不断学习新技术、寻找解决方案或寻求专业帮助。
2.解决策略: 对于常见的技术挑战,有多种解决方法可供选择。例如,通过优化代码、使用缓存技术等方法可以提高网站的加载速度;通过多浏览器测试、性能监控等方法可以确保网站在不同设备和浏览器上都能正常工作。
七、结论:通过以上内容的阐述,我们可以看到,网站网页制作是一个涉及多个方面的复杂过程。从基础知识的学习到高级主题的应用,再到用户体验的提升、现代工具和技术的使用以及维护与更新的策略,每一个环节都至关重要。只有不断学习和实践,才能成为一名优秀的网站开发者。在未来的工作中,让我们继续探索新的知识和技术,为打造更好的网站贡献自己的力量。